CESL issues tender to procure 1 lakh electric three-wheelers

Mahua Acharya, MD and CEO, had said that CESL has aimed to catalyse large scale transformation of the transportation system in India by focusing on accessibility and affordability.

The State-run, Convergence Energy Services Ltd (CESL), had floated a tender for acquiring 1 lakh electric three-wheelers for different use cases like freight loaders, garbage disposal, food and vaccine transport and passenger autos.

Original equipment manufacturers had been invited to provide quotations for electric three-wheelers, to be used under various mentioned use cases and posy the procurement of these vehicles, CE would lease them to the entities that wish to avail such leasing services.

For any entity that would be interested in buying, CESL would make the e-three-wheelers available on their digital platform for outright purchase, and all the vehicles would comply with the FAME-II policy requirements.

CESL had issued a tender to procure the EV’s in order the fulfilling the demand aggregated from their various partners and states across the country. The cities aim to transform their garbage collection fleet from fossil fuel to electric power which would be greener and cheaper to operate. The tender’s huge part consists of the demand for vehicles that would be used to deliver vaccines and provide employment.

OEM’s would be responsible for manufacturing, designing, testing, engineering, inspection, transportation, supply, transit insurance, and system warranty, delivery of the product to the end consumer and also providing after-sales support.

CESL through the tender and procurement of e-three wheelers aims to reduce cost, standardise the demand for these vehicles and maintain high quality and service levels through the implementation of quality assurance and quality control procedures, they were also working on providing electric two-wheelers, three-wheelers, four-wheelers, electric buses and their associated charging infrastructure.
